Planning Your Visit

Climb to the Top

Prepare for a climb! The Point Arena Lighthouse boasts 144 steps to its lantern room. While the views are spectacular, ensure you're comfortable with heights and physical exertion. The winding staircase requires a backward climb at the top, a standard for these historic structures. Instagram+1

Coastal Winds & Costs

This coastal gem can be breezy, so pack layers even on sunny days. Be aware that there's an entrance fee per person, plus an additional charge to climb the lighthouse. Some visitors found it a bit pricey, opting to enjoy the views from the overlook. InstagramReddit

The History of Point Arena Lighthouse

First lit in 1870, the Point Arena Lighthouse stands as a testament to maritime history on the rugged Northern California coast. It was originally built to guide ships along this treacherous stretch of the Pacific. The original structure was tragically destroyed in the great 1906 San Francisco earthquake, but a new, even taller lighthouse was constructed and has been guiding mariners ever since. Instagram+1

Today, the lighthouse is a National Historic Landmark and is maintained by a dedicated non-profit organization. Visitors can explore the museum, which houses a magnificent Fresnel lens, and learn about the lives of the lightkeepers and the vital role the lighthouse played in maritime safety. The preservation efforts ensure that this iconic structure continues to inspire awe and educate future generations. InstagramReddit

Experiencing the Climb

The ascent to the top of the Point Arena Lighthouse is an experience in itself. With 144 steps winding upwards, it's a physical journey that rewards visitors with unparalleled views. The narrow, circular staircase is a classic feature of many historic lighthouses, and here, it culminates in a balcony offering 360-degree vistas of the Pacific Ocean and the surrounding coastline. Instagram+1

Be prepared for the final steps, which require climbing backward – a standard safety measure for lighthouses of this design. While it might seem daunting, the staff, like Benjamin mentioned by visitors, are often on hand to offer guidance and ensure a safe experience. The effort is well worth it for the breathtaking scenery and the sense of accomplishment. Reddit
